Goring-by-Sea station is equipped with a variety of facilities to ensure your travel is comfortable and convenient. Ticket purchasing is straightforward with both a ticket office and accessible ticket machines available, including facilities for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. These machines are accessible by design, although it's wise to review the station map regarding accessibility.
Despite the lack of waiting rooms or first-class lounges, there are ample seating areas to rest while waiting for your train. You'll also find dedicated spaces for bicycle storage, handy for cycling enthusiasts who use their bikes to commute to and from the station. Free parking is available at the station, operated by APCOA Parking UK, including specific spaces reserved for those with accessibility needs.
The station provides several accessibility measures, including step-free access and assistance ramps for train access. Assistance by friendly station staff can be arranged in advance or on a 'turn up and go' basis during operating hours. Although the station lacks some amenities like accessible toilets or baby changing facilities, the travel assistance features make navigating the station manageable for those needing support.
For those looking to continue their journey beyond the train, Goring-by-Sea offers several transport links. Local buses provide a seamless connection to surrounding areas. For more specific journey planning, passengers can refer to the 'Onward Travel Information Map' available at the station. Ryder Brow station has basic facilities to cater to commuter needs, offering accessible ticket machines and an induction loop for those with hearing impairments. Interestingly, there's no staffed ticket office or ticket machine for collecting purchased tickets. That means online booking and printing your own tickets before your journey could be the ideal way to secure your trip.
The station is categorized as having step-free access, although accessing services towards both Manchester and New Mills involves descending a stepped ramp. It's also worth noting the absence of CCTV, waiting rooms, wheelchair availability, or refreshment facilities. However, there is a seating area available for passengers who might need to take a break.
Ryder Brow is well connected through various transportation links, making it convenient to explore surroundings or journey further afield. There are local buses running on Levenshulme Road that connect to areas like Chorlton and Cheetham Hill. For any rail replacement services, pickup is on Ryder Brow Road. If you're in need of a taxi, Northern Railway offers a handy service with Cab4You, which can be reached through their website.
Calling to cyclists, be aware that there are no bicycle storage facilities or hire services directly at the station, so plan accordingly if you're traveling with two wheels.
